/// <summary> ???????/// 加密 ???????/// </summary> ???????/// <param name="Text">要加密的文本</param> ???????/// <param name="sKey">秘钥</param> ???????/// <returns></returns> ???????public static string Encrypt(string Text, string sKey="test") ???????{ ???????????DESCryptoServiceProvider des = new DESCryptoServiceProvider(); ???????????byte[] inputByteArray; ???????????inputByteArray = Encoding.Default.GetBytes(Text); ???????????des.Key = ASCIIEncoding.ASCII.GetBytes(Md5Hash(sKey).Substring(0,8)); ???????????des.IV = ASCIIEncoding.ASCII.GetBytes(Md5Hash(sKey).Substring(0, 8)); ???????????System.IO.MemoryStream ms = new System.IO.MemoryStream(); ???????????CryptoStream cs = new CryptoStream(ms, des.CreateEncryptor(), CryptoStreamMode.Write); ???????????cs.Write(inputByteArray, 0, inputByteArray.Length); ???????????cs.FlushFinalBlock(); ???????????StringBuilder ret = new StringBuilder(); ???????????foreach (byte b in ms.ToArray()) ???????????{ ???????????????ret.AppendFormat("{0:X2}", b); ???????????} ???????????md4j= ret.ToString(); ???????????return ret.ToString(); ???????}
/// <summary> ???????/// 解密 ???????/// </summary> ???????/// <param name="Text"></param> ???????/// <param name="sKey"></param> ???????/// <returns></returns> ???????public static string Decrypt(string Text, string sKey = "test") ???????{ ???????????DESCryptoServiceProvider des = new DESCryptoServiceProvider(); ???????????int len; ???????????len = Text.Length / 2; ???????????byte[] inputByteArray = new byte[len]; ???????????int x, i; ???????????for (x = 0; x < len; x++) ???????????{ ???????????????i = Convert.ToInt32(Text.Substring(x * 2, 2), 16); ???????????????inputByteArray[x] = (byte)i; ???????????} ???????????des.Key = ASCIIEncoding.ASCII.GetBytes(Md5Hash(sKey).Substring(0, 8)); ???????????des.IV = ASCIIEncoding.ASCII.GetBytes(Md5Hash(sKey).Substring(0, 8)); ???????????System.IO.MemoryStream ms = new System.IO.MemoryStream(); ???????????CryptoStream cs = new CryptoStream(ms, des.CreateDecryptor(), CryptoStreamMode.Write); ???????????cs.Write(inputByteArray, 0, inputByteArray.Length); ???????????cs.FlushFinalBlock(); ???????????return Encoding.Default.GetString(ms.ToArray()); ???????}
/// <summary> ???????/// 32位MD5加密 ???????/// </summary> ???????/// <param name="input"></param> ???????/// <returns></returns> ???????private static string Md5Hash(string input) ???????{ ???????????MD5CryptoServiceProvider md5Hasher = new MD5CryptoServiceProvider(); ???????????byte[] data = md5Hasher.ComputeHash(Encoding.Default.GetBytes(input)); ???????????StringBuilder sBuilder = new StringBuilder(); ???????????for (int i = 0; i < data.Length; i++) ???????????{ ???????????????sBuilder.Append(data[i].ToString("x2")); ???????????} ???????????return sBuilder.ToString(); ???????}
调用加密 解密看效果
?????public static string md4j = ""; ???????static void Main(string[] args) ???????{ ???????????//加密 ?????????Encrypt("123456"); ?????????Decrypt(md4j); ???????}
